Abstract

1,030,069. Tunnel furnace. L. CHOMAT. Nov. 6, 1964 [Nov.16, 1963; Sept 29, 1964], No. 45403/64. Heading F4B. A tunnel furnace comprises a plurality of independant sections 1 linked together by nuts and bolts, a compression spring being inserted beneath each nut to compensate for thermal expansion effects. The sections each comprise a metal frame 2 holding refractory brickwork supported on a carriage 3 on non- driven rollers 4 orientatable in any direction. The sections are linked by bolting together their corner members 5 (Fig. 2, not shown). Circular iron rods, carried by the sections 1 to form rails, along which carriages supporting materials to be treated, move, are linked together through smaller diameter rods located in blind sockets in their ends (Fig. 4, not shown) to allow for thermal expansion. Return sets of rails 16, outside the furnace proper are carried by extended cross-members 15 supported on foot 18 and roller 4.
